Police Seek Help To Locate Missing Boy Hamilton

Police are currently searching for and appealing for public assistance as they search for missing Albanvale boy Harrison.

The 13-year-old was last seen on Mulhall Drive in St Albans on 26 July about 3pm.

Police and family have concerns for his welfare due to his age, a medical condition and his disappearance being out of character.

He is described as being about 150cm tall, with a medium build and short black hair.

Harrison was last seen wearing a black hooded jumper, black tracksuit pants and a black school bag.

His lack of clothing and shelter have caused further concern due to the weather conditions overnight.

Officers have been told Harrison is familiar with the Brimbank Plaza and Watergardens Shopping Centre areas.

Investigators have released an image of Harrison in the hope that someone can provide information on his current whereabouts.

Anyone with information on his whereabouts is urged to contact Sunshine Police Station on 03 9313 3333.
